Output e2446ac8a4a7a9b288547b240bc66a7138518de31f0e000a30a86843ba31f848:1

value
1509019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a2433a3c2b5f24cc4b7806c77492ef28f726ad7 OP_EQUAL
address
3CpqjHa2YmLJQ6vfRdw8cskvXNQn14Z1MV
transaction
e2446ac8a4a7a9b288547b240bc66a7138518de31f0e000a30a86843ba31f848
confirmations
291473
spent
true